About us
We are a privately held, Vancouver-based remote-working company striving to save lives through digital empathy, and our solution - Tickit - is being used to help hundreds-of-thousands of people in Canada, the US, and Australia every year. We’re saving lives and helping vulnerable people in need of help.
Your role will focus on both shaping our technical strategy and actively writing code to build and enhance the Tickit platform for data collection, management, visualization, and AI integration. You’ll have a direct impact on the platform’s scalability and efficiency, reaching thousands of users globally.
As an experienced Full-Stack Developer, you enjoy taking ownership of projects from start to finish. You’ll be responsible for both the back-end and front-end development work, ensuring the platform continues to evolve and meet the needs of diverse users. This is a hands-on role where you’ll independently solve challenges, write clean, efficient code, and continuously improve the platform.
You’ll work closely with the CEO and other stakeholders to ensure that the technical solutions align with the business goals. You also understand the importance of privacy and security regulations, especially in healthcare and education, and ensure your code meets these critical requirements.
You bring a combination of proven technical skills and a passion for innovation in areas such as:
* Ruby on Rails
* JavaScript, TypeScript
* Docker / Kubernetes
* Respect for comprehensive automated testing
Our current Javascript codebase consists of SPAs using TypeScript, Angular, RxJS. Our Rails stack is primarily used to create RESTful API endpoints for our SPAs. The whole stack is deployed and managed with Kubernetes.
Responsibilities
Leadership
* Management / Leadership of the Development Team
* Contribute to platform architecture including scaling.
* See through a project from conception to finished product.
Full Stack Development
* Develop progressive web applications.
* Design user interactions on web pages.
* Ensure cross-platform optimization for mobile devices.
* Ensure responsiveness of applications.
* Design and develop APIs.
* Maintain servers and databases.
Requirements
You have at least 3 years full stack experience and:
* Proficiency with server-side languages such as Ruby.
* Proficiency with fundamental front end languages such as HTML, CSS and JavaScript.
* Strong organizational and project management skills.
* Familiarity with JavaScript frameworks such as Angular and React.
* Familiarity with database technology such as PostgreSQL and MySQL.
* Excellent verbal communication skills.
* Good problem-solving skills.
* Prior Experience leading / managing a team is a plus
Job Types: Full-time, Part-time
Pay: $110,000.00-$150,000.00 per year
Benefits:
Dental care
Extended health care
Flexible schedule
Life insurance
Paid time off
Stock options
Work from home
Schedule:
Monday to Friday
Education:
Bachelor's Degree (preferred)
Experience:
Ruby on Rails: 5 years (required)
Kubernetes: 4 years (preferred)
JavaScript: 3 years (required)
Work Location: Remote